Transaction 32c83baf512212f6b097bd6c347d7ea6614e8b763f24f4686f78677e6f914614

2 Input
1 Outputs
  • 32c83baf512212f6b097bd6c347d7ea6614e8b763f24f4686f78677e6f914614:0
  • value  3392313
    address  19aw1QuZ6SrrLkZ9CZ9iWhDcuvUmkX6xFX